Dular ABSTRACT A study of the reverse flow phenomenon at the outlet of a rotating axial diffuser with a circular cross-section is presented in the paper. Measurement of the flow velocity components was performed by the LDA system. In addition, computer-aided visualization of the flow structures was carried out. The results showed a certain dependence of the position and size of the recirculation zone in the diffuser outlet transverse section on the amount of airflow and on the rotating frequency of the diffuser. The computer-aided visualization method proved to be more suitable for detecting the position and shape of the reverse flow regions.
